About The Position

Under the direction of the Activity Director, the Activity Aide is responsible for the provision of activities functions to SNF residents and documentation of same.   • Provides individual and group activities to residents under the direction of the Activity Director.
  • Works with other departments to foster a multidisciplinary approach toward providing residents with activity programs that meet their preferences and needs.
  • Assures that the individual resident care plans are addressed in the facilitation of activity programs.
  • Relates to residents in an enthusiastic, creative manner to assure the maximal participation in each activity program.
  • Assists with the total care and well being of facility pets.
  • Maintains documentation of resident activity program participation in accordance with all applicable laws and regulations.
  • Participates in the volunteer program for the SNF residents, assists with recruitment, training and supervision of volunteers while in the facility.
